Operations: what is operation management (om: operations is the set of activities that creates value in the form of goods and services by transforming inputs into outputs. Activities creating goods and services take place in all organizations: operations management is the design (planning, organizing) execution (staffing, leading), and improvement (controlling) of these transformations processes that create value.
